@All translators: as a reminder, instructions are here.

I plan to provide an RC ISO soon, so the most urgent translation work is on the files auto (which gathers messages from the "functions" script superseding the "auto" script), rc.S (modified from the one in a Slackware installer) and the HandBook.

I will include in this ISO all translations of auto and rc.S at least 80% translated, but if you miss this train don't worry: I will provide a new ISO as soon as a new locale meets these requirements. Folks having installed using the incoming RC ISO will not have to reinstall when a new one or a stable one is published, using slapt-get or gslapt will be enough as for any package update showing in this ChangeLog.
